10 days from Chch I would hit Oamaru, Curio bay in the Catlins and Stewart Island, potentially flying out of Invercargill. Not very snow heavy but could visit a ski field from either Chch or Oamaru. More of a nature or scenic vibe.
Or could loop down the east coast, Oamaru and the catlins, then head back up through central Otago.
Queenstown really just a scenic touristy hellhole now, I’d avoid and stay in Cromwell if going through that area.

Get your head around renting. Your life is changing significantly, why burden yourself with a mortgage until you are in a more settled position. Renting might cost similar but you don’t have to worry about unexpected house bills etc, it’s a single amount and doesn’t change. Your proceeds from the sale give you a huge buffer and safety net which disappears if you buy a house. A friend did exactly what you are proposing and was made redundant shortly after buying the house, give yourself some breathing room.
